目前,Flink SQL Client 不支持指定具体的 Yarn Session ID。 如果你想指定 Yarn Session ID,可以使用 Flink Standalone 或者 Kubernetes。 在Flink Standalone 中,你可以在启动 Flink 集群时指定 Yarn Session ID。在Kubernetes 中,你可以在创建 Flink 应用时指定 Yarn Session ID。如果你需要在 Flink SQL Client ...
2.查看 log 简单,Flink on Yarn,Flink on Kubernetes 太依赖于外部组件,而 Flink Standalone 集群的 log 查看起来就简单的多,直接使用 less 命令查看即可。 3.SQL 任意组合执行,改动成本低。关于Flink SQL CLI 可访问 https://nightlies.apache.org/flink/flink-docs-release-1.17/docs/dev/table/sqlclient/接...
log4j-session.properties:Flink 命令行在启动基于 Kubernetes/Yarn 的 Session 集群时使用(例如 kubernetes-session.sh/yarn-session.sh); log4j-console.properties:Job-/TaskManagers 在前台模式运行时使用(例如 Kubernetes); log4j.properties: Job-/TaskManagers 默认使用的日志配置。sqlclient在提交的时候是不是就没...
Flink SQL Client是Flink的SQL客户端组件,用于交互式地查询和分析Flink任务中的数据。它支持多种查询方式和数据可视化工具,如Jupyter Notebook、Zeppelin等。 2.24.Flink SQL Flink SQL是Flink的SQL查询组件,用于实现基于SQL的数据查询和分析。它支持多种SQL语法和查询引擎,如Apache Calcite等。 2.25.Flink SQL Library ...
内容:所有原创文章分类汇总及配套源码,涉及Java、Docker、Kubernetes、DevOPS等; 关于Flink SQL Client Flink Table & SQL的API实现了通过SQL语言处理实时技术算业务,但还是要编写部分Java代码(或Scala),并且还要编译构建才能提交到Flink运行环境,这对于不熟悉Java或Scala的开发者就略有些不友好了; SQL Client的目标就...
Kubernetes 是一个开源的容器编排引擎,Flink 可以作为 Kubernetes 上的一个容器化应用程序进行部署。 在Kubernetes 上部署 Flink 可以实现资源的动态调度和弹性扩展,支持快速部署和管理。 Amazon EMR: Amazon EMR 是亚马逊提供的弹性 MapReduce 服务,支持在云中部署和管理 Flink 集群。 在Amazon EMR 上部署 Flink 可以...
flink-container: Flink对docker和kubernetes的支持。 flink-contrib: 社区开发者提供的一些新特性。 flink-core: Flink核心的API、类型的定义,包括底层的算子、状态、时间的实现,是Flink最重要的部分。Flink内部的各种参数配置也都定义在这个模块的configuration中。(这部分代码还没怎么看过,就不细讲了)。
Kubernetes: Kubernetes 是一个开源的容器编排引擎,Flink 可以作为 Kubernetes 上的一个容器化应用程序进行部署。 在Kubernetes 上部署 Flink 可以实现资源的动态调度和弹性扩展,支持快速部署和管理。 Amazon EMR: Amazon EMR 是亚马逊提供的弹性 MapReduce服务,支持在云中部署和管理 Flink 集群。
Temporal Joins 允许 Streaming 数据与不断变化/更新的表的内存和计算效率的连接,使用处理时间或事件时间,同时符合ANSI SQL。 流式SQL 的其他功能除了上面提到的主要功能外,Flink 的 Table&SQLAPI已经扩展到更多用例。以下内置函数被添加到API:TO_BASE64,LOG2,LTRIM,REPEAT,REPLACE,COSH,SINH,TANH。SQL Client 现在...